I remember how big the Scott Pilgrim series was, and how well it captured the early 2000s nerd zeitgeist. I remember how popular this movie was, and how it was viewed as such a great springboard into the graphic novels. I also remember howI remember how big the Scott Pilgrim series was, and how well it captured the early 2000s nerd zeitgeist. I remember how popular this movie was, and how it was viewed as such a great springboard into the graphic novels. I also remember how Scott Pilgrim underwent a critical re-evaluation where everyone distanced themselves from the franchise as a result the manic-pixie-dream-girl archetype coming under well deserved scrutiny. Ramona Flowers is the peak manic-pixie-dream-girl and you're lying to yourself if she's not. People argued that this movie romanticized the toxic behavior of putting someone on a pedestal, and people really straight up abandoned Scott Pilgrim over this. They may have been right.

Now that the critical controversy has died down, does this movie hold up?

I think it does. Its ironic because the whole movie is about Scott learning to NOT put Ramona on a pedestal and to actually treat her as a person. The movie is funny and heartfelt. The effects, performances, and gags are great. Edgar Wright really elevated this movie into something great. Definitely check this one out.

Edgar Wright is such of a creative and courageous director, he puts in this movie a style that you probably have never seen in any other movie ever. The movie does have a bunch of aspect in different ways that entretain you, not just becauseEdgar Wright is such of a creative and courageous director, he puts in this movie a style that you probably have never seen in any other movie ever. The movie does have a bunch of aspect in different ways that entretain you, not just because it is really good, but because is a completely different kind of work that isn't usual at all. First i would like to talk about the sounds in the movie, it is mastered perfectly, like the sounds fit and combine with what is happening during the scene, it is so enjoyable and natural at the same time, the director did some tricks in transitions in scene to scene that is just phenomenal. The visual of the movie is another factor that makes this movie so iconic and unique, it does apply some video game hud, putting life, combos counting, the pose of fight games, that is so great.
The acting for me was perfect, Michael Cera was the perfect casting for this character, he really is a big nerd and like his character he naturally pass all of the insecurity and charisma that the character should, you totally connect and cheers for him. Mary Elizabeth Winstead as Ramona Flowers may be the best character in the movie, she had a nice arc and she totally delievers it with the nonsense aspects of the movie.
The supporting actors are all great, every single member of the legion of evil have some personality stereotyped and are all interesting and fun, the gay friend did a great job, so as her first girlfired and his hole band, everyone did a nice job in here, and definely is a good example of way this movie worked.
The story is another unbelievable aspect of the movie and make this movie even more great. Is basically a guy that nerds can relate a lot, he have a girlfriend and a difficult situation with girls in the past. He finds another girl and desperately wants to date her, and for do this, he needs to fight and defeat all of her 7 ex boyfriends. He literally fight in a completely poetic license way, it is so great, Wright creativity during the most part of those battles is just unthinkable and surprises you all the time with some crazy and creative decisions. The story isn't bad and it does make sense, but the movie doesn't take itself seriously, so it is not a problem at all the nonsense stuff that happens.
I like how the movie does a lot of little critics on the society, mainly during the dialogues of the battle, and isn't scary to go off in these, you can see a bunch of moments as a big metaphor into some real thing. Another thing that it is very interesting, is that you can take for your life, Ramona Flowers character is aprisioned by her past, it is impessing her to go and improve in her life, and needs to fight it to move on. In Ramona case was her relationships, but could be anything else in some real life person. She always disappear of the places to run away from her past, for guilty. She does have a duality, that starts even with her name. Like in a video-game, we pass throw levels, second, third chances are given to us all the time, even when a game over seems to happen, they teach that to us. I love how the movie says that you need to understand you and respect yourself, it is told with metaphors and, for me, it was great.
The comedy of the movie is on point, Michael Cera character have such of a unique personality but at the same time you can see him in a bunch of people and probably in you. All aspects help in the comedy, the sounds, the cinematography and everything, surely you will laugh a lot watching it.
It uses aesthetically interesting shooting angles, using various screen formats during projection to portray narrative elements such as the scope of battles or the solitude of the characters. In turn, one uses the visual versatility of the director to play with the extremes that involve the coloring of the world of the long.
I believe that something that could have been a little bit better, are the action scenes, after the half of the movie during some fight scenes i saw myself distracted and not very into what was going on, maybe tooked to long to solve some fights, it may disconnect you from the movie during some minutes.
This movie is just great, it is unique and you have probably have seen really few things with more personality and more courage than this movie, it does have unique sounds asepcts, visuals and a great montage. You will laugh with the creativity of the director and the lines plus other aspects well connected and a nonsense metaphorical story that teachs some nice stuff.

Whenever Michael Cera is in a movie, there is always a connection between the Independent world and mainstream media. In other words, Cera usually stars in movies with an "Indie" theme but is geared towards the general audience (i.e Nick AndWhenever Michael Cera is in a movie, there is always a connection between the Independent world and mainstream media. In other words, Cera usually stars in movies with an "Indie" theme but is geared towards the general audience (i.e Nick And Norah, Juno). In this case, Edgar Wright's (Shaun Of The Dead, Hot Fuzz) Scott Pilgrim Vs. The World explores the world of pop culture using a combination of video games and indie rock.

Scott Pilgrim is an adaptation of the obscurely-known comic book series of the same name. Pilgrim, the bassist of the fictitious band Sex Bomb-omb, is a somewhat socially awkward Canadian that always finds himself in a bad relationship. He later meets a dead-pan hipster named Ramona Flowers (Mary Elizabeth Winstead) and soon dates her. But before Pilgrim can continue to date the mysterious girl, he must defeat her seven-evil exes in glamorous video game-like sequences.

The aspect that makes this movie stand out is its beautiful and clever art direction. Edgar Wright, who is famous for multiple cult hits, directs a film that thoroughly emulates the feel of a comic book/video game. From the apparent onomatopoeias to the video game life bars, the audience gets the feeling that they are watching something truly unique.

The other main characteristic that makes this film work is, as stated earlier, its countless references to pop culture and the Independent-music genre. With music composed by alt-rocker Beck, Canadian band Broken Social Scene, and Metric, this music is stuffed with Indie goodness that will make a hipster smile in their plaid cardigan and wayfarers (Small easter egg: Pilgrim's roommate was reading a fake newspaper with a Neko Case advertisement in it. This is totally irrelevant but it made me smile). It also occasionally ridicules the subculture in a friendly joking manner poking fun at veganism, "mainstream" labels, and common memes ("The first album was so much better than the first first album"). It also obviously succeeds in channeling the video game world with its boss battles and the occasional Zelda reference.

While all this said, the film is far from perfect. The concept of the boss battle gets stale quick; What is amusing at first becomes repetitive and dull. The number of exes, although accurate to the comic book series, is just too much to handle in two hours that it made me wish the final battle would happen twenty minutes earlier. Additionally, the battles are equally immense so its hard to discern that Cera's character is conquering anything significant. The film has a run-time of 112 minutes, and it lost its steam at the three quarter mark. What also is flawed is that the movie is simply brainless and does not have much substance. While I do not expect a movie called Scott Pilgrim Vs. The World to be much of a thought provoker, I just thought that it was too silly for its own good. With an outlandish amount of slapstick humour, it was really hard to see this movie as more than a summer movie.

Scott Pilgrim Vs. The World is a blast. It is filled with so much action and humour that it is definitely worth the price of admission for music and video game lovers alike. There is no doubt that it will become a cult hit just as Edgar Wright's other movies have. But with its lack of substance and excessive silliness, it is disappointing that the movie could have been so much more than a fun two hours to spend.
